Voice Chat Programs
Many games these days include multiple methods of communication between yourself and your team-mates. However there will come a time when keyboard (typed communications) just doesn’t make the grade and this is when you will find the Voice over IP(VoIP) software tools available.
These tools allow you to chat in real-time with your team-mates to allow for more effective co-ordination / explanation of strategies.
All that is generally required to utilise such programs is a working microphone and to have a common-installed (i.e. the same program as your friends)
Ventrilo
Ventrilo, or sometimes called Venty or Vent is one of the best (VoIP) tools available. It has a very clean and easy to use interface. The Ventrillo client software is released as freeware and available for anyone to download and use (the Server software however requires licensing fees).
When connecting to a Ventrilo server, you can set-up or join different channels, many servers have different channels for different purposes or even different games. You can set a name of your character when joining a Ventrilo server, when some one is speaking - the speaker next to their name should go green.

TeamSpeak
Also referred to as TS, TeamSpeak is another popular voice chat tool for online gamers. A TeamSpeak server is split up into separate channels/rooms - usually defined by game title or team side (be it clan or game opponents), they can also be password protected to disallow the general public or opposing team from joining a channel.
There are 2 different ways initiate the voice capture, you can either bind a key to utilise a push to talk setup or there is also an option to automatically engage when you speak. Each player has their own preference, so it's important to work out what works best for you.

In-Game Voice Chat
Many new game titles in recent times are recognising the need for voice chat services and have as a result, included such a service built-in the game. Counter-Strike and Battlefield 2 are two examples of games which have a VoIP function built-in.
Voice Chat Etiquette
Here are some very loosely defined and upheld rules of voice chat programs. Use them as a guideline, and when in doubt - type what you have to say instead!
Test your Voice Chat
Many Programs have a in-built test function, this basically allows you to test and test how you would really sound through the program. This can address many problems, such as being too soft-sounding, too loud, distorted and will even test if your microphone works at all!
Keep it short and precise
The idea of voice chat programs is to deliver communication when typing may not be an option, such as in the middle of a firefight etc. With this in mind, try and keep all communication short and sweet, which generally means refrain from off-topic conversation if it is not warranted.
Speaking over one-another
Try not to speak over other players, wait until they are finished before you start speaking.
